#3b0b3c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b0b3c is composed of 23.1% red, 4.3%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.7% cyan, 81.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 76.5% black. It has a hue angle of 298.8 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 13.9%. #3b0b3c color hex could be obtained by blending #761678 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#3b0b3c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a020a is the darkest color, while #fef9fe is the lightest one.
